Output 8864418de2b7cc102e9f01b021a4a937b741257ed627f51b0ddfe98a9e519ca6:1

value
1588000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fec68dbd7926e066aa18dc3d22a475903ce39214 OP_EQUAL
address
3Qv9R26W44bMxk9B7oacP5fCf3wdWpDZAW
transaction
8864418de2b7cc102e9f01b021a4a937b741257ed627f51b0ddfe98a9e519ca6
spent
true